Falcons, Lady Tigers Get Return Dates
Stories from Emeka Enechi and Pius Ayinor in Athens

After hectic seat search processes in Athens, the Super Falcons and Lady Tigers are set to leave Athens for Lagos. The female footballers are scheduled to leave Greece today while the basketballers would depart tomorrow by their various schedules.

An official of Team Nigeria confirmed to

THISDAYSports that the Falcons have had their seats confirmed following the arrangements began since they lost the quarter finals game to world champions Germany Friday.

"They (Falcons) will leave tomorrow.It is now certain as their bookings have been confirmed," he said.

By the arrangements, the Falcons will fly through Germany aboard a Lufthansa flight while the basketballers who are mainly United States based are going aboard British Airways via London.

The Falcons, whom we learnt are billed for a reception in Lagos later in the week, are virtually going home as a group. For the basketballers, it's slightly different as majority of the players are going back to the United States. Most of them who only played for the country for the first time joined the team at the German camp.

The departure programme has remained a hectic one for many of the athletes and visitors to the Games. Despite the increased number of flights for the period by the airlines, securing a seat in and out of the Greek capital city has remained tough. Although entry to the city slightly reduced by weekend, it is on the rise again as many holiday seekers troop in for the Games' closing ceremony on Sunday.

An unidentified KLM female official told us on phone the pressure could go down from mid next week.

"For now, our seats remain fully booked in and out of

Athens until Wednesday (September 1st). Coming in was a few percent lighter by weekend but we are fully loaded this period," she said.

For some other countries departures have begun. Some members of the Korean delegation left on Tuesday while some

Chinese are leaving today.
